Definitions of frank:
  • noun:   a smooth-textured sausage of minced beef or pork usually smoked; often served on a bread roll
  • noun:   a member of the ancient Germanic peoples who spread from the Rhine into the Roman Empire in the 4th century
  • verb:   exempt by means of an official pass or letter, as from customs or other checks
  • verb:   stamp with a postmark to indicate date and time of mailing
  • adjective:   clearly manifest; evident
    Example: "Frank enjoyment"
  • adjective:   characterized by directness in manner or speech; without subtlety or evasion
    Example: "Tell me what you think--and you may just as well be frank"
  • name:  A male given name (common: 1 in 172 males; popularity rank in the U.S.: #31)
  • name:  A surname (rare: 1 in 4000 families; popularity rank in the U.S.: #453)
  • name:  A female given name (common: 1 in 50000 females; popularity rank in the U.S.: #2691)
